Parallel searching method for speech recognition
A speech recognition and search method technology, applied in speech recognition, speech analysis, instruments, etc., can solve the problems that hardware resources cannot be fully utilized, the load balance of processor calculations cannot be effectively controlled, and the distribution of search paths cannot be guaranteed. Achieve low communication overhead and realize the effect of computing load balance
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ment Construction
[0033] In the process of speech recognition, the calculation amount of token expansion (including Gaussian probability calculation of speech frame) accounts for more than 80% of the calculation amount of the entire search engine. In the environment of multi-processors or multi-core processors, in order to speed up the search operation, the present invention proposes a method for performing parallel operation on token expansion by using multi-threads.
[0034] There is data dependency in the token extension process in the token chain list of multiple states, and it still ends with Figure 4 As an example, assume that the active token linked lists of states i2, i3 and j1 are H i2 、H i3 and H j1 , at time t-1, there are two active tokens T in each of the above token linked lists 11 (t-1)-T 12 (t-1), T 21 (t-1)-T 22 (t-1) and T 31 (t-1)-T 32 (t-1), at time t, it is necessary to expand the active tokens in the three state token lists respectively, and the expansion order of...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 